Ethereal-dev: Re: [Ethereal-dev] patches to add interface descriptions

Note: This archive is from the project's previous web site, ethereal.com. This list is no longer active.

From: Guy Harris <guy@xxxxxxxxxxxx>
Date: Wed, 2 Jul 2003 18:09:54 -0700

On Wednesday, July 2, 2003, at 6:01 PM, Nathan Jennings wrote:

Attached are patch files I've created with "cvs diff" against anon cvs
as of yesterday morning. The patches add an optional interfaces description string to the capture preferences dialog. The description string looks like:

eth0(eth0 descr),eth1(eth1 descr),...

So does this add the ability for the *user* to add a description, over and above whatever description the OS supplies, if any?

If so, then perhaps it should default that description to the one the OS supplies, and let the user override that, rather than having two descriptions on OSes where the OS supplies one (currently only Windows, but at some point libpcap might dig up descriptions on some UNIXes) - the OS description is often just a model name, and an explicit user-supplied description might render the OS description unnecessary (not that a model name is all that useful on a multi-homed machine with multiple interfaces of the same type anyway).

That might be simpler than having two description strings for interfaces.